Course Content

• Gender Equality in Therapeutic Practice
• Intersectionality and Gender: Understanding Multiple Identities
• Trauma-Informed Care and Gender-Based Violence
• Gender Identity and Expression: Counseling LGBTQ+ Clients
• Feminist Theories and Approaches to Counseling
• Working with Men and Masculinities
• Power Dynamics and Gender Inequality in Counseling Relationships
• Advocacy and Social Justice in Gender Equality Counseling
• Ethical Considerations in Gender-Sensitive Counseling

A Professional Certificate in Gender Equality in Counseling equips counselors with the knowledge and skills to effectively address gender inequality within their practice. This specialized training enhances their ability to provide culturally sensitive and inclusive therapy, promoting gender justice and well-being for diverse client populations.


Learning outcomes for this certificate program typically include a deep understanding of gender identity, gender roles, and the impact of gender-based violence. Students develop proficiency in applying gender-sensitive therapeutic approaches, including feminist therapy and intersectional perspectives. Critical analysis of power dynamics and systemic inequalities are also integral to the curriculum, fostering ethical and effective counseling practices.
